RAF Ternhill (IATA: N/A, ICAO: EGOE) is a small Royal Air Force station at Ternhill in Shropshire, near the towns of Newport and Market Drayton. The station was a helicopter base. It is now principally used as an outpost for the tri-service helicopter training establishment at RAF Shawbury. Training flights use the airfield (as do gliders at the weekends) but many of the buildings and some local MOD housing (much of which was sold off, some people queueing for days to buy a property) are now part of the army base known as Clive Barracks(after Robert Clive - see Market Drayton) . Also houses VGS 632. used by the air training corps EC+SM (East Cheshire and South Manchester) wing and Staffordshire wing.
